Balkenbush Mechanical Inc Salary

As of August 2026, the average annual salary for employees at Balkenbush Mechanical Inc in the United States is $84,416. This translates to an approximate hourly wage of $41. Salaries at Balkenbush Mechanical Inc typically range from $74,362 to $95,259 annually, reflecting the diverse roles and experience levels within the company.

About Balkenbush Mechanical Inc
Balkenbush Mechanical is a full service HVAC company. We employ the best and most experienced Installers and Service Technicians available to us. Our Service Technicians have years of experience with multiple brands and models of equipment, and will quickly, professionally, and efficiently repair, replace, or install all of your heating/cooling, plumbing, Electrical, and refrigeration needs. What Is the Cost of Living Near Jefferson City?

Understanding the cost of living near Jefferson City is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Balkenbush Mechanical Inc.
Jefferson City's Cost of Living Index is approximately 82.4 (17.6% less expensive than US average; 7.4% less than MO average). State capital, affordable housing. JEFFTRAN. When planning your budget based on a salary from Balkenbush Mechanical Inc,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$750 - $1,150+ A significant portion of Balkenbush Mechanical Inc sal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$140 - $230 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ation $25 (JEFFTRAN monthly pass)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$370 - $550 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$300 - $580+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$350 - $640+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$1,935 - $3,155+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
